Preparation
- Preheat the oven to 375°F (190°C).
- In a bowl, blend the Boursin, cream cheese, mozzarella, and 1 tablespoon of hot honey until smooth.
- Lightly oil a small baking dish and transfer the cheese mixture into it, smoothing the top.
Baking
- Drizzle the remaining hot honey over the top. Sprinkle with thyme and red pepper flakes, if desired.
- Bake for 15–18 minutes until edges are bubbly and top is golden brown.
Serving
- Crack fresh black pepper over the top and garnish with an extra drizzle of hot honey. Serve warm.
Notes
Store leftovers in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 3 days. Can be prepared a day in advance and frozen for up to a month.
